Abstract

A blast resistant vehicle is disclosed that includes a structural frame member, a first frame coupled to the structural frame member and configured to receive a first axle assembly and a first suspension assembly, a second frame coupled to the structural frame member and configured to receive a second axle assembly and a second suspension assembly, and a cab assembly having a front portion and a rear portion and having a floor panel, a front firewall, a rear body panel, a first side panel, and a second side panel. The cab assembly is isolated from the structural frame member, the front sub-frame, and the rear sub-frame.

1. A blast-resistant vehicle, comprising:

a structural frame member including a structural tunnel having a curved upper portion extending downward into a first side wall and a second side wall;

a first frame coupled to the structural frame member and configured to receive a first axle assembly and a first suspension assembly;

a second frame coupled to the structural frame member and configured to receive a second axle assembly and a second suspension assembly;

a cab assembly coupled to the structural frame member and having a front portion and a rear portion and including a floor panel, a front firewall, a rear body panel, a first side panel, and a second side panel, wherein the cab assembly is isolated from the structural frame member, the first frame, and the second frame; and

a front isolated joint configured to support the cab assembly, wherein the front isolated joint includes a frame bracket coupled to the structural frame member, a cab bracket coupled to the cab assembly, and a resilient member.

11. An military vehicle, comprising:

a blast resistant assembly including:

a front sub-frame assembly including a front suspension and a front axle,

a rear sub-frame assembly including a rear suspension and a rear axle,

a structural frame member coupled to the front sub-frame and the rear sub-frame,

an armor assembly coupled to the frame member, and

a prime mover coupled to at least one of the front sub-frame and the rear sub-frame; and

an isolated cab assembly having an outer surface, wherein spacing between the outer surface of the isolated cab assembly and the blast absorbing assembly defines a blast gap,

wherein the armor assembly comprises a plurality of panels having overlapping edges to protect the isolated cab assembly from debris, the plurality of panels including an under body panel extending from the structural frame member, a side armor panel coupled to the under body panel, and a door armor plate coupled to a side of the cab assembly.

12. The military vehicle of claim 11 , wherein the blast gap surrounds the isolated cab assembly.

13. The military vehicle of claim 11 , wherein the blast gap is at least 0.25 inches.

14. The military vehicle of claim 11 , wherein the side armor panel extends upward past a bottom edge of the door armor plate to provide ballistic overlap protection.
